WebJul 1, 2010 · Anatta or non-self is one of the three characteristics of the phenomenal existence. It is the unique and central teaching of Buddhism. It is the unique and central teaching of Buddhism. According to this doctrine there is no permanent or everlasting self or soul either inside or outside the five aggregates which constitute a being. spedition bayer und sohn trier
